Oh, I found a chart of housing rates from 2008 for Central London and Outer London. A 1 bedroom house or flat was 265.12 pounds in CL and 160.36 pounds in OL, this is the price per week. A 2 bedroom house or flat was 375.70 pounds in CL and 212.26 pounds in OL per week. I'm sure the prices are higher now.
